Part-Time TikTok & Social Content Assistant Remote | 15–20 hours/week | Paid 30-day trial The Job We’re building an AI app that helps women figure out what to do next when they’re dealing with problems around money, work, business, or life. The app is already live. Now we need more people to discover it, try it, and become paying users. We’re looking for someone who really understands TikTok, Reels, short-form content, and internet culture. You should know what makes someone stop scrolling. You should be able to look at a trend and know whether we should use it or ignore it. You should be able to take a basic idea and turn it into a strong hook, script, or video concept. And you should be comfortable figuring things out without waiting for someone to tell you every single step. This is not just a “post on social media” job. Your job is to help us make content that gets attention and turns that attention into people trying our product. ________________________________________ What You’ll Do Every Week You’ll work from a simple list of priorities from the founder. From there, you’ll help run the content machine. 1. Find good content ideas Spend time on TikTok, Instagram, YouTube, Reddit, comments, and other places our audience hangs out. Look for: • Topics people are talking about • Questions our audience keeps asking • Trends we could use • Hooks that are working • Video styles we should test • Good examples from other creators and brands We don’t want to copy people. We want you to understand what is working and why. 2. Turn ideas into videos Each week, you’ll help create short-form content for TikTok, Instagram Reels, and YouTube Shorts. That includes: • Video ideas • Hooks • Short scripts • Captions • Calls to action • Dialogue for our AI character • Examples for our video editor to follow You do not need to edit every video yourself. We already have someone who helps create and edit the videos. Your job is to make sure they know what we’re making and what it should look and feel like. 3. Keep the content moving Once a video idea is approved, you own getting it across the finish line. That means: Idea → Script → Editor → Final Video → Posted The founder should not have to ask: “Did this ever get posted?” 4. Find creators we can work with Each week, find smaller TikTok and Instagram creators whose audience fits our product. You’ll: • Find creators • Keep a list of good ones • Reach out by DM or email • Follow up • Help coordinate collaborations We’re looking for people with the right audience, not just people with huge follower counts. 5. Pay attention to what happens We don’t care about views just for the sake of views. We want to know: Did people click? Did they try the product? Did they sign up? Did they pay? Every week, you’ll give us a simple update: What did we post? What worked? What didn’t? What did we learn? What should we try next? No giant marketing reports. Just tell us what happened and what you think we should do about it. ________________________________________ Weekly Meetings You will also have a weekly check-in meeting over Zoom or Google Meet with the founder. This is a short working session to: • Review what was posted • Discuss what worked and what didn’t • Align on new content ideas • Make sure priorities are clear for the next week No formal presentations needed — just a working conversation. ________________________________________ What We Expect Each Week A normal week may include: • Researching new TikTok/Reels ideas and trends • Creating 10+ short-form content ideas/hooks • Turning the best ideas into 5–10 ready-to-produce scripts or content briefs • Sending clear instructions/examples to our editor • Making sure finished content gets posted • Finding 10–25 possible creators we could work with • Reaching out and following up with creators • Reading comments and finding new content ideas from our audience • Testing at least one new idea to help more people discover or try the product • Sending a short weekly report showing what happened and what we should do next The exact numbers may change as we learn what works. ________________________________________ You’re Probably a Great Fit If… You spend enough time on TikTok that you understand the language of the platform. You know when something feels like an ad. You know when a hook is boring. You understand why some videos make people stop scrolling and others don’t. You’re a strong, natural writer. You can write the way real people talk, not like a company brochure. You’re comfortable using ChatGPT and other AI tools. You’re curious. You test things instead of overthinking them. And when we say: “Find 20 creators who might be good for this product.” You don’t need us to explain how to search TikTok, build the list, find their contact information, and start reaching out. You figure it out. ________________________________________ This Is Probably NOT For You If… You need every task explained step-by-step. You mainly know traditional corporate marketing. You write captions that sound like ads. You don’t personally use TikTok or understand current internet culture. You only care about followers, likes, and views. Or you tend to wait for someone to tell you what to do next. We need someone who can take a goal and run with it. ________________________________________ How to Apply Start your application with: Sassy AI Then answer these questions. 1. Show us your work. Send 2–3 TikToks, Reels, or Shorts you personally helped create. Tell us exactly what you did. 2. Show us your taste. Send us one TikTok or Reel you think is really good. Tell us why you think it worked. Keep your answer simple. 3. Show us you can write a hook. Imagine our customer says: “I hate my six-figure job, but I can’t afford to take a huge pay cut. I feel stuck.” Give us 3 TikTok hooks you would test. 4. Which video wins? Video A: 100,000 views → 5 people sign up Video B: 8,000 views → 75 people sign up Which one interests you more? Why? 5. Find creators. Tell us how you would find 25 smaller creators who might be a good fit for an AI app made primarily for women figuring out money, work, business, and life decisions. 6. Tell us about AI. What AI tools do you currently use? What do you use them for? 7. Are you comfortable reaching out to creators? This includes sending DMs/emails and following up when people don’t answer. Yes or no — and tell us about any experience you have doing this. ________________________________________ What Happens Next We’ll choose a small number of applicants for an interview. The strongest candidates will receive a paid test assignment using the same kind of work you’ll actually do in this role. The person we hire will start with a paid 30-day trial. We’re not looking for the person with the fanciest marketing résumé. We’re looking for someone who gets social media, has good instincts, writes like a human, moves quickly, and gets things done.
